About This Novel
Before meeting Xia Ya, System C-137's wish was to be bound to a kind and smart host, download dungeons, complete tasks, torture scum, pretend to be cool and slap people in the face. Upgrade and add some skills if there is nothing to do, and work together to create a better tomorrow! After meeting Xia Ya, System C-137's wish became - Mom, this host is so scary. Even if it forcibly binds me, it can actually cut off my connection with the mother system? Also, can each of these copies be more brutal? It's either ghosts or the end of the world, crying~ I don't want to be a stand-alone system, and I don't want to get involved in the battle between the host and the mother system. I just want to go back to the mother planet to retire, ~~ Copy 1: The host is seeing ghosts every day Copy 2: The host is running away from marriage every day Copy 3: The host is playing mahjong every day Copy 4: The host is poisoning every day Copy 5: The host is cultivating immortality every day... Key point: No cp! This may be a long comment
This book is actually quite good. The writing is very smooth The heroine's character is amazing Call for no male protagonist (づ ●─● )づ Why not many people watch it? I have the following guesses: ① The publicity is not strong enough, so your book has not been recommended on the home page (I saw this book from someone else's book list) ②The author's writing style of this book has certain flaws. The language is coherent, but too bland and the details are not enough. When writing an article, pay attention to the ups and downs. The beginning, climax, and end are like a wavy line. ~The story is gripping and only readers will love it ③The author's handling of the character's language and dialogue is not perfect That system in particular seems to have a lot of nonsense. I hate this the most. The system feels a bit like a licking dog, and it really talks too much. I know that the author is trying to explain the meaning of the text clearly, but this kind of explanation in the dialogue mode only gives people a long-winded, full-screen dialogue, and the full-screen words "dissuade" some readers. As the old saying goes: talk less and do more ps: Don't look at what I have said. If you ask me to write an article myself, I will definitely not be able to write well. After all, it takes me more than an hour to write an 800-word argumentative essay (/ ̄(エ) ̄)/ emmm, this book is actually good, I hope the author can work harder ٩(๑òωó๑)۶ (This is my destiny to give you a cute look👀)
